High-Level Vision

Examines the perceptual processes by which humans and other animals are able to obtain knowledge about the three-dimensional environment.
Prereq: A grade of C- or above in 2220, 2300, and 3310; or a grade of C- or above in 3310, a grade of B or above in 3313 and Neurosc 3000, and Neuroscience major; or Grad standing.
